Whale swimming at Vava'u Tonga,  
All the whale swim companies pick you up by boat from your resort. Then everyone is on lookout for a tell tale blow. We were lucky enough to swim with this mum and baby in August 2015. The baby was estimated to be 2 weeks old. It is a wonderful experience to swim with these magnificent creatures but it is strenuous work in swell and current and very deep water. But worth the effort.
